Ministry Partner Development Coach - Support Hub The purpose of the Ministry Partner Development Coach is to maximize GFM’s impact globally by supporting the financial development of GFM staff. The Ministry Partner Development Coach role is focused on equipping and coaching GFM Appointees and Staff through the support raising process and monitoring staff account funding. This ministry role can be part-time and support-raising is required. The Ministry Partner Development Coach has the ability to work on site and from home on a regular basis. The role can be based out of Atlanta, Georgia.
